Output e5683f3294e98d3bc7d0fab6d1744e503277f31fa74dfb94d1c0706425bfc14d:2

value
17905245
script pubkey
OP_0 OP_PUSHBYTES_32 353591758cd5baa22a4dc2a83a15d2b62103e40941ed652e5d3abc8f5e4c2a88
address
bc1qx56ezavv6ka2y2jdc25r59wjkcss8eqfg8kk2tja827g7hjv92yqpztku9
transaction
e5683f3294e98d3bc7d0fab6d1744e503277f31fa74dfb94d1c0706425bfc14d
spent
true